SARMs vs Prohormones: A Comparative Analysis of Performance Enhancement
Stepping into the realm of athletic performance enhancement, performance compounds often emerge as focal points. These substances, designed to mimic testosterone's, offer tantalizing benefits for athletes seeking an edge. However, understanding the nuanced variations between SARMs and prohormones is crucial before embarking on any enhancement regimen. Both pathways activate androgen receptors within the body, accelerating muscle growth and strength gains. Yet, their chemical structures and modes of action diverge significantly.
- Selective Androgen Receptor Modulators, as the name suggests, selectively target specific androgen receptors, primarily those found in muscle tissue. This targeted approach minimizes {undesirableadverse reactions that often accompany traditional anabolic steroids.
- Prohormones, on the other hand, are precursors to hormones like testosterone. When ingested, they are transformed by the body into active hormones, often with greater systemic impact than SARMs.
The choice between SARMs and prohormones depends heavily on individual goals, risk tolerance, and desired outcomes. SARMs offer a potentially safer route for targeted muscle growth while minimizing hormonal disruption. Conversely, prohormones can yield more dramatic results but carry a higher risk.
